ECXWW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

48 of the 6,310 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ECARX Holdings Warrants (ECXWW)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$823K — down 75% from $3.28M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in ECXWW was balanced in Q3 2023: 1 fund opened new positions, 1 closed out, 0 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.

The largest buyer was UBS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$13. The largest seller was Boothbay Fund Management, cutting an estimated $13.4K.
